CHAPEL HILL, N.C. - Duke's Reid Carleton and Henrique Cunha claimed the doubles championship of the Wilson/ITA Carolina Regionals on Monday with an 8-4 win over Iain Atkinson and Steve Forman of Wake Forest at the Cone-Kenfield Tennis Center in Chapel Hill.
"It is a big win for us," said Cunha. "We had a great semifinal match yesterday against a good doubles team and today was a very intense, high level match. I am very happy to be playing in National Indoors."
With the win, the two Duke players earn a spot in the doubles draw at the ITA National Indoor Championships. The Championships will be held Nov. 5-8 at Yale University in New Haven, Conn.
"It is a huge win for us," said Carleton. "National Indoors is a really big tournament so I am really excited to get there."
Carleton and Cunha have now won eight consecutive doubles matches and are 14-2 overall on the season with three wins over ranked opponents. The only two losses have come against the No. 1 and No. 6 doubles teams in the nation. The Duke pair lost in a tiebreaker against No. 1 John-Patrick Smith and Davey Sandgren of Tennessee in the finals of the UVA Ranked Plus One Invite. The results have been pretty good for a doubles team who never stepped on the court with each other prior to the first match they played in together.
"It has worked out for us," said Carleton. "They put us together the first tournament of the year and we had never even hit a ball with each other. We struggled through our first match of the year but won and from then on we have just been cruising."
The duo added to their trophy case with Monday's ITA Regional Championship. In the previous tournament, Carleton and Cunha suffered a first round loss to No. 6 Moritz Baumann/Marek Michalicka of Wisconsin at the ITA All-American Championships but battled back to win the backdraw title.
"Both of us are returning so well, both in today's match and yesterday's match," said Carleton. "It is hard for teams to get in any kind of rhythm with their serves because they don't know what to do against us. We have them on their heels from the beginning."
The two players have played extremely well together with three 8-3 wins, seven 8-4 victories and three 8-5 wins on the year. During their eight-match winning streak, only one match has been decided by less than three games, an 8-6 win over Tulsa's Ashley Watling and Philip Stephens in the consolation semifinals of ITA All-Americans.
"We are playing very well in our baseline game," said Cunha. "We are serving good and have been good in our volleys. The way we have been playing has helped our confidence as we have won eight matches in a row now."
The way Carleton and Cunha have played together this fall, they will be looking at a high national ranking when the next individual rankings come out in January. But first they will try to win another championship in three weeks at the ITA Indoor National Championships.
